- Ted Houk Regatta Seattle Canoe and Kayak Club
In 1969, Dr Houk obtained the old Aqua Theater at Green Lake from the Seattle Department of Parks and Recreation in which to build and store boats With a club space now available, Ted Houk and Ben Dotson founded the Seattle Canoe Club

- History Seattle Canoe and Kayak Club
HISTORY OF THE SEATTLE CANOE AND KAYAK CLUB by Dr Eric Hughes (Revised April 2010) The Seattle Canoe Club was founded “officially” in 1969 by Dr Theodore “Ted” Houk and Ben Dotson, but its roots go back to the late 1950’s In the fifties and sixties Ted Houk began designing and building flatwater canoes and kayaks Dr
